0
한 websevers 하나 개의 웹 사이트 한 페이지, 각 사용하여 SQL 서버 2005 서버에IIS 5.0을 실행하는 웹 서버가 여러 dbserver 연결을 어떻게 처리합니까?
세 명의 사용자 클라이언트
이 dbservers 다른 데이터베이스를
을 표현할 때
에 자신의 컴퓨터 클릭에서 페이지에 액세스하는 클라이언트의button A ---- connect to 'table1' of db 'first' on dbserver1
button B ---- connect to 'table1' of db 'second' on dbsever2
질문이 내 경험에 의하면, 하나의 연결이 열렸을 때 연결을 여는 다른 시도가 거절되고 연결이 alr이라고 말합니다. 그곳에 먼저 문을 닫아야합니다.
웹 서버 IIS 5.0에서 어떻게 처리하나요? 한번에 연결을 허용 하시겠습니까?
나는 내 질문에 답변자에 대한
명확하지 않다 생각 : -
예 SQL 서버는 여러 개의 연결
을 수 있지만 두 개의 서로 다른 컴퓨터에서 실행되는 두 개의 SQL 서버가 있습니다.
편집 된 SQL Server가 아닌 하나의 SQL Server를 참조하십시오. yes SQL Server에서 다중 연결을 허용합니다. 두 개의 서로 다른 컴퓨터를 실행하는 두 개의 SQL Server가 있습니다. – user287745
그리고 각각의 연결을 여러 개 열어도 문제는 없습니다. 원하는 개별 연결마다 다른 SqlConnection 개체를 사용해야합니다. 각 사용자는 요청에 의해 분리됩니다. 따라서 사용자 당 각 데이터베이스에 하나의 연결이 필요한 경우 요청 당 최대 두 개의 SqlConnection 개체가 필요합니다. – Sekhat